Thanks to a grant from State Farm, the El Paso Community College (EPCC) Fire Technology Program will provide education on home safety and fire prevention this weekend.
The informational sessions, at both the EPCC’s Northwest Campus and Mission del Paso Campus, will be curbside and feature fire prevention information, home safety as well as carbon monoxide and smoke detectors.
Tips will be provided by the Fire Tech Program on how to appropriately respond to various emergencies which might be encountered in the home or workplace, raging from gas leaks to fire.
The EPCC Fire Technology Program is training first responders for emergencies in our community. The Associate of Applied Science Degree in Fire Science Option provides students with professional-level education to meet personnel needs in the fire science field.
The Certificate satisfies the Texas Commission on Fire Protection’s requirements for Texas Basic Structure Fire Protection Certification. Students are also eligible for International Fire Service Accreditation Congress (IFSAC) seals.
